Proof of Point for some elementary changes in the way Dante has to do combos to get damage now. The first combo is clearly more "complicated", longer, has more attacks, etc. And yet, the second one does more damage. Because of the way Damage Scaling brings Dante's damage to ROCK BOTTOM, now, Dante's combos can no longer achieve better raw damage just by adding on to the end of it. Dante's combos, when it comes to raw damage, must now be about packing as much Impact as possible into the beginning of the combo, in terms of Hit Count.
